Weekly rainfall update + rainfall outlook 16 Jan 2024

On the 9th and 10th, a broad band of heavy rain with embedded thunderstorms moved across south-eastern Australia impacting parts of Victoria, New South Wales, Queensland and the Northern Territory.

There were thunderstorms, some severe, across Queensland and parts of the New South Wales in a moist easterly airflow.

Increased rainfall and storm activity across the tropical north signalled the approaching monsoon trough; bringing heavy rain, thunderstorms, gusty winds and cooler conditions to the tropical north.
